Who needs to national firearms act?
01
The National Firearms Act applies to individuals or entities that intend to possess or transfer certain types of firearms and devices, including:
02
- Individuals purchasing or owning Title II firearms, such as machine guns, short-barreled rifles, short-barreled shotguns, or suppressors.
03
- Firearms dealers, manufacturers, or importers dealing with Title II firearms or other NFA-regulated items.
04
- Trusts or corporations seeking to possess or transfer Title II firearms or NFA-regulated items.
05
- Individuals inheriting NFA firearms from a deceased relative or obtaining them through other lawful means.
06
It's important to note that compliance with the National Firearms Act and its regulations is mandatory for those who fall under its jurisdiction.

What is to national firearms act?
The National Firearms Act (NFA) is a United States federal law that regulates the manufacture, transfer, and possession of certain firearms.
Who is required to file to national firearms act?
Anyone who intends to manufacture, transfer, or possess certain firearms, such as machine guns, short-barreled shotguns, and silencers, is required to comply with the NFA regulations.
How to fill out to national firearms act?
To comply with the NFA, individuals must complete the appropriate forms, such as ATF Form 1 for manufacturing and ATF Form 4 for transferring firearms, and submit them to the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ives (ATF).
What is the purpose of to national firearms act?
The purpose of the National Firearms Act is to regulate certain firearms to ensure they are not misused for criminal purposes, such as organized crime or acts of terrorism.
What information must be reported on to national firearms act?
The NFA forms require information such as the applicant's identifying details, the firearm's specifications, and certification that the applicant is not prohibited from possessing firearms under federal or state law.
